D3 Slider Filter. function drawExplosions(startDay, endDay) { explosions. selectAl

         

function drawExplosions(startDay, endDay) { explosions. selectAll("path") //make a Getting started D3 works in any JavaScript environment. slider(). When I use the slider, it displays dots but not ones I The top-level selection methods, d3. When we get an event, we need to add a new filter I want to filter data from a csv using a slider (d3-slider) in a simple scatterplot. . The first thing we need to do is add this slider to the user interface (our website). filter I've added below. I took the adjustable-threshold example as a reference. Contribute to MasterMaps/d3-slider development by creating an account on GitHub. scaleTime() d3-time d3-time-format The slider is showing Process ^ But as far as I can tell, it doesn’t seem to have an effect on lines, no matter how thick. ) In this notebook we will build an interactive scatterplot that animates changes Dynamic data filtering in D3. This article shows how to create zoom behaviours, how to add zoom and pan constraints and how to D3 timelineMake a pseudo-gantt chart thingy with icons For your really long charts, it supports scrolling. The event we want to listen for is called input. For more info see: d3. select and d3. See the . Below you can play around with the glow effect. max(2100). Use this online d3-simple-slider playground to view and fork d3-simple-slider example apps and templates on CodeSandbox. I am trying to use a range slider to filter line charts. Here's a pretty simple way to encode a date range onto a slider in D3. Click any example below to run it instantly or find templates that can be Let's do this with a slider. Click Now we need add another event listener that changes the year the moment we touch the slider. min(2000). js enables interactive data exploration by allowing users to selectively show or hide visualization elements based on specific criteria. D3 provides a module 'd3-zoom' that adds zoom and pan behaviour to an HTML or SVG element. It can even do things on hover, click, and scroll for when someone accidentally interacts with your . slider and st. You must include the d3 library before including the slider file. The d3-simple-slider functionality is added to D3. Range slider has a mediator role, it takes your data, does the filtering and outputs filtered data, you can use filtered data in your notebook That said, if your A few code chuncks describing the most common data manipulation needed in d3. Try D3 online The fastest way to get started (and get help) with D3 is on Observable! D3 is available by default in notebooks as part of I modified some d3 filtering blocks with the intention to filter by year (ideally through a slider instead of having a button for each year) but encountered two issues: upon calling filter() and ex The JavaScript library for bespoke data visualizationAlternatively, use zoom. This is to change the text under the slider, save the selected value in a variable and update the table: In this video, I'll walk through how to add a date range slider to a D3 Area chart. At the beginning of this tutorial the foundations of D3 namely D3 Ordinal Slider to Filter Data Asked 10 years ago Modified 10 years ago Viewed 1k times D3. selectAll, restrict selection to descendants of the selected The JavaScript library for bespoke data visualizationAccelerate your team’s analysis Create a home for your team’s data analysis where you can spin up The difference between st. js. GitHub Gist: instantly share code, notes, and snippets. axis(true). js plot, and allows it to interact with the chart. The d3-simple-slider functionality is added to Filter map with slider in d3. The d3-simple-slider functionality is added to Slider with min, max and step values d3. css as a template Container must have position: relative in the style Range can be modified from JS using for D3 Tutorial This is a short interactive tutorial introducing the basic elements and concepts of D3. There are three ways to use this library. This slider will filter the visualized dataset based on a dynamic start and end date, and redraw the entire There are three ways to use this library. You can then draw your explosions with a function that takes the values from your slider. My problem is that the filter is a little bit anarchic. Thus, it ignores leap seconds and can only work Quarto includes native support for Observable JS, a set of enhancements to vanilla JavaScript created by Mike Bostock (also the author of D3). There are three ways to use this library. Observable JS is distinguished by its reactive runtime, D3. selectAll, query the entire document; the subselection methods, selection. js slider. js SVG range slider component with interactive controls for data filtering, zooming, and responsive visualizations. select_slider is that slider only accepts numerical or date/time data and takes a range as input, while select_slider How to any type of button to your d3. Now, the slider is filtering the data, but each time the slider is moved, new (This document is based on an original notebook by the UW Interactive Data Lab. Use d3RangeSlider. Applying the zoom behavior also sets the -webkit-tap Searching for a range slider (not available at Jeremy’s input bazare) , I came across d3-simple-slider, which I almost have working: The problem seems to be that the demo examples, as The d3-time module does not implement its own calendaring system; it merely implements a convenient API for calendar math on top of ECMAScript Date. filter for greater control over which events can initiate zoom gestures. Explanation and reproducible code. A slider element is actually an input element with the the type range. step(5) Then we define an event listener that is always called when the slider is changed. select and selection. Then you can add the compiled js file to your website. Technical details Depends on D3 (v4 - v5) Must be styled through CSS. Includes filtering, sorting, nesting and more.

9ifqmkc1
ehwjy8
mcq9iwrg8o
zdlwxuu
ylscya
holddnwnm
ez84ut
pxc8cgiat0
r73lwekeh
norjumz7